Deputy Jennifer Carroll MacNeill asked the Minister for Transport if companies that report to him such as the Irish Aviation Authority, have a compulsory retirement age of 65 years of age; if not, if they are included under the Public Service Superannuation (Age of Retirement) Act 2018;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[36963/20]

View answer

Written answers

The issue raised is a matter for the agencies under the aegis of my Department. I have referred the Deputy's question to the agencies for direct reply.  Please advise my private office if you do not receive a response within ten working days.
